Searched refs:nr_segs (Results 1 - 4 of 4) sorted by relevance
/freebsd-13-stable/sys/contrib/openzfs/include/os/linux/spl/sys/ |
H A D | uio.h | 98 unsigned long nr_segs, offset_t offset, zfs_uio_seg_t seg, ssize_t resid, 104 uio->uio_iovcnt = nr_segs; 134 uio->uio_iovcnt = iter->nr_segs; 97 zfs_uio_iovec_init(zfs_uio_t *uio, const struct iovec *iov, unsigned long nr_segs, offset_t offset, zfs_uio_seg_t seg, ssize_t resid, size_t skip) argument
|
/freebsd-13-stable/sys/contrib/openzfs/module/os/linux/zfs/ |
H A D | zpl_file.c | 251 zfs_uio_iovec_init(uio, to->iov, to->nr_segs, pos, 352 unsigned long nr_segs, loff_t pos) 360 ret = generic_segment_checks(iov, &nr_segs, &count, VERIFY_WRITE); 365 zfs_uio_iovec_init(&uio, iov, nr_segs, kiocb->ki_pos, UIO_USERSPACE, 390 unsigned long nr_segs, loff_t pos) 399 ret = generic_segment_checks(iov, &nr_segs, &count, VERIFY_READ); 408 zfs_uio_iovec_init(&uio, iov, nr_segs, kiocb->ki_pos, UIO_USERSPACE, 468 loff_t pos, unsigned long nr_segs) 471 return (zpl_aio_write(kiocb, iov, nr_segs, pos)); 473 return (zpl_aio_read(kiocb, iov, nr_segs, po 351 zpl_aio_read(struct kiocb *kiocb, const struct iovec *iov, unsigned long nr_segs, loff_t pos) argument 389 zpl_aio_write(struct kiocb *kiocb, const struct iovec *iov, unsigned long nr_segs, loff_t pos) argument 467 zpl_direct_IO(int rw, struct kiocb *kiocb, const struct iovec *iov, loff_t pos, unsigned long nr_segs) argument 480 unsigned long nr_segs = iter->nr_segs; local [all...] |
/freebsd-13-stable/sys/dev/mlx4/mlx4_en/ |
H A D | mlx4_en_tx.c | 648 int nr_segs; local 776 mb, segs, &nr_segs, BUS_DMA_NOWAIT); 788 mb, segs, &nr_segs, BUS_DMA_NOWAIT); 796 if (nr_segs != 0) { 808 ds_cnt = (dseg - ((volatile struct mlx4_wqe_data_seg *)tx_desc)) + nr_segs; 851 dseg += nr_segs + pad; 863 while (nr_segs--) { 864 if (unlikely(segs[nr_segs].ds_len == 0)) { 872 dseg->addr = cpu_to_be64((uint64_t)segs[nr_segs].ds_addr); 875 dseg->byte_count = SET_BYTE_COUNT((uint32_t)segs[nr_segs] [all...] |
/freebsd-13-stable/contrib/llvm-project/compiler-rt/include/sanitizer/ |
H A D | linux_syscall_hooks.h | 1677 #define __sanitizer_syscall_pre_vmsplice(fd, iov, nr_segs, flags) \ 1679 (long)(nr_segs), (long)(flags)) 1680 #define __sanitizer_syscall_post_vmsplice(res, fd, iov, nr_segs, flags) \ 1682 (long)(nr_segs), (long)(flags)) 2966 void __sanitizer_syscall_pre_impl_vmsplice(long fd, long iov, long nr_segs, 2969 long nr_segs, long flags);
|
Completed in 185 milliseconds